Ordinals
beta
Sat 90499689570033
decimal
18099.4689570033
degree
0°18099′1971″4689570033‴
percentile
4.3095090318848905%
name
nfbtrhbfqkm
cycle
0
epoch
0
period
8
block
18099
offset
4689570033
timestamp
2009-06-26 09:21:55 UTC
rarity
common
prev
next